
ANDY WARHOL (1928 – 1987)
$ (Quadrant), 1982
101.6 x 81.3 cm (40 x 32 in)
Printer: Rupert Jasen Smith, New York
Publisher: Andy Warhol, New York
Edition: 60, 10 AP, 3 PP
Materials: From the portfolio of two screenprints on Lenox Museum Board
Markings: Signed and numbered in pencil
Catalogue: Feldman & Schellmann II.284

Each print is unique.
In this series of screenprints, Warhol was exploring compositional and color changes and assembled the portfolios in mixed variations as he had done in Shadows I-V, 1979.
Based on images found in commercial typography.
Stamped in red on the reverse © Andy Warhol 1982.
Since each print is unique the locations of the signature may vary.
Bears the printer's chop mark.
Warhol made paintings of this subject.
